GJEPC commences India Australia BSM!

The Gem and Jewellery Export Promotion Council (GJEPC) commences the India Australia Buyer Seller Meet (BSM) with inauguration on August 7 & that to run through August 9 in Mumbai. In three days BSM the Australian players would also visit SEEPZ SEZ.

 

Inaugural event witnessed Vice-Chairman, GJEPC, Shri Colin Shah, Mr Jeremy Keight, Buyers by the Coordinator of BSM, Dilipbhai-GJEPC Gujarat & ED-GJEPC Sabyasachi Ray on the dais among the presence of Buyer delegation, Sellers from India & invitees!

 

Colin Shah said about GJEPC to buyers. He also referred India Argyle relationship. Before India that joins Argyle just 25% of diamonds were of gem quality & rest Industrial gem. Equation that changes right with the India –Argyle tie up and Argyle provided 75% gem quality of diamonds!

 

Over this 25 years India has started with young team & players. As of today Jewellery exports of India is larger than China & Thailand, thus India is the global leader in gem-n-jewellery. Equally India is known for its diamond jewellery!   

 

While saying gem-n-jewellery, India is processing 90% of global rough in volume & in the term of value, India shares 75% of the total global market. He said, GJEPC plays a crucial role as a trade facilitator! He wishes all those players, Buyer-n-seller to reach a good business & deal!

 

At the occasion Jeremy Keight said about the unique situation & opportunity to source from India. Priorly he introduced every buyer that was from Australia & Ireland. In a formal talk he said Nayan Jani that they would remain in India and attend the IIJS.

 

From seller side there are showcases of Fine Jewellery, Intergold, Uni-Design, KBS Creation, Tache Jewellery, V M Jewellery & others joined with their cutting edge crafts-n-designs with ut-most finishing!
